What is Helix BioPharma EV-to-EBITDA?

Helix BioPharma HBPCF 28 EV-to-EBITDA is -30.90 as of Jul. 16, 2026. GuruFocus rates HBPCF with a GF Score™ of 28/100. Among 395 Biotechnology companies, Helix BioPharma ranks worse than 253164.3% on this metric.

EV-to-EBITDA is calculated as enterprise value divided by its EBITDA. As of today, Helix BioPharma's enterprise value is $73.57 Mil. Helix BioPharma's EBITDA for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Apr. 2026 was $-2.38 Mil. Therefore, Helix BioPharma's EV-to-EBITDA for today is -30.90.

Helix BioPharma EV-to-EBITDA Calculation

Helix BioPharma's EV-to-EBITDA for today is calculated as:

EV-to-EBITDA=Enterprise Value (Today)/EBITDA (TTM)
=73.569/-2.381
=-30.90

Helix BioPharma's current Enterprise Value is $73.57 Mil.
Helix BioPharma's EBITDA for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Apr. 2026 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was $-2.38 Mil.

Helix BioPharma Business Description

Other Exchanges HBP0:GermanyHBP:Canada
Address 40 Temperance Street, Suite 2700, Bay Adelaide Centre - North Tower, Toronto, ON, CAN, M5H0B4
Helix BioPharma Corp is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company developing therapies in immune-oncology focused on cancer prevention and treatment. The Company is developing a proprietary platform of bio-conjugates targeting hard-to-treat solid tumors over-expressing CEACAM6, including Tumor Defense Breaker, L-DOS47, and three CEACAM6-specific antibody-drug conjugates. Its pre-IND candidates include LEUMUNA, an oral immune checkpoint modulator for hematological malignancies, and GEMCEDA, an oral prodrug of gemcitabine for solid tumors.
